The Read can be a single Read of a data array, a mask array, an SRAM, or a register location (CMD[2] = 0). It can be a burst
Read of the data (CMD[2] = 1) or mask array locations using an internal autoincrementing address register (RBURADR).
A description of each type is provided in Table 12-3. A single-location Read operation lasts six cycles, as shown in Figure 12-1.
The burst Read adds two cycles for each successive Read. The SADR[21:19] bits supplied in Read instruction cycle A drive
SADR[21:19] signals during the Read of an SRAM location.

Reads a single location of the data array, mask array, external SRAM, or device
registers. All access information is applied on the DQ bus.
Reads a block of locations from the data or mask arrays as a burst. The RBURADR
specifies the starting address and the length of the data transfer from the data or
mask array, and it autoincrements the address for each access. All other access
information is applied on the DQ bus.
SRAM can only be read in single-Read mode.
